Reusing your wash water
Your storage tub holds the wash water from
your last wash load. The soils in the wash
water settle to the bottom of the storage tub
and remain in the storage tub when the wash
water is pumped back into the washer. Drain
the storage tub after the wash water is
pumped back into the washer.
1. Set the Cycle Control Knob to SUDS
RETURN. Do not add load items at this
time.
2. Pull out the Cycle Control Knob. The
washer pumps most of the wash water
from the storage tub back into the washer
basket.
3. When Suds Return is complete, push in
the Cycle Control Knob.
4. Add about l/2 the recommended amount of
detergent and your wash load.
5. Turn the Cycle Control Knob clockwise to
the desired cycle and wash time.
6. Pull out the Cycle Control Knob to start the
washer.
7. Drain the storage tub.
Using rinse and spin
When using extra detergent for heavily soiled
clothes, or washing special-care items, you
may find an extra rinse and spin is needed.
1. To add an additional rinse, push in the
Cycle Control Knob and turn clockwise to
RINSE, as illustrated.
2. Pull out the Cycle Control Knob. The
washer fills to selected load size,
agitates, drains, and spins.
Using drain and spin
A drain and spin may help shorten drying
times for some heavy fabrics or special-care
items by removing excess water.
1. Push in the Cycle Control Knob and turn
clockwise to SPIN, as illustrated.
2. Pull out the Cycle Control Knob. The
washer drains, then spins.
